PEOPLE v. WATROBA

No. 104343, COA No. 160373.

547 N.W.2d 649 (1996)

450 Mich. 971

PEOPLE of the State of Michigan, Plaintiff-Appellant, v. John Michael WATROBA, Defendant-Appellee.

Supreme Court of Michigan.

January 17, 1996.


ORDER

On order of the Court, the application for leave to appeal is considered and, pursuant to MCR 7.302(F)(1), in lieu of granting leave to appeal, we REVERSE the judgment of the Court of Appeals. There was no objection in the trial court. The issue on which the Court of Appeals reversed cannot be considered absent compelling or extraordinary circumstances, People v.
